Files
GenericCounter/docs/Waveforms/Generic Counter.json
Max P 102babf95d Updated GenericCounter with new features and documentation
Enhanced the GenericCounter VHDL module by adding a comprehensive set of features, including synchronous reset, clock enable, configurable counting direction, over- and underflow flags, and lookahead value. Introduced detailed project documentation, including a descriptive README, waveform diagrams in both SVG and JSON format, and a UCF constraints file specifying clock settings.
2024-03-16 14:44:06 +01:00

68 lines
1.5 KiB
JSON

{
"signal": [
[
"General",
{
"name": "CLK",
"wave": "P.....|........",
"node": "0123456789abcde",
"period": 1
},
{
"name": "RST",
"wave": "10....|.....10."
},
{
"name": "CE",
"wave": "0.1...|........"
}
],
[
"Set",
{
"name": "Set",
"wave": "0.....|..10...."
},
{
"name": "SetValue",
"wave": "x.....|..8x....",
"data": [
"5"
]
}
],
[
"Counter",
{
"name": "CountEnable",
"wave": "0..1..|.......0"
},
{
"name": "CounterValue",
"wave": "4..777|77777777",
"data": "0 1 2 3 15 0 5 6 7 8 1 1"
},
{
"name": "LookAheadValue",
"wave": "4..777|77777777",
"data": "1 2 3 4 0 1 6 7 8 9 2 2"
}
],
[
"Flags",
{
"name": "OverUnderflow",
"wave": "0.....|.10....."
}
]
],
"config": {
"hscale": 1
},
"head": {
"text": "<b>Generic Counter</b>"
},
"foot": {
"text": "RST Value = 0"
}
}